Output efbbf8a4bfc6129137de49c638fb6b2277e26b1a2d75bb5e9b1c494f97e683fc:1

value
23892
script pubkey
OP_0 OP_PUSHBYTES_20 3dcd6a6582caa6422dd7dbc2ca6c9f128412bd41
address
bc1q8hxk5evze2nyytwhm0pv5mylz2zp902p4xmk0p
transaction
efbbf8a4bfc6129137de49c638fb6b2277e26b1a2d75bb5e9b1c494f97e683fc
confirmations
65915
spent
true